Sacramento Report BY JON SMOC K & RON K I NGSTON

New Notice Requirements

A

s referenced in last month’s legislative article, a new state law dealing with pesticides went into effect January 1, 2016. Senate Bill 328 added Section 1940.8.5 to the Civil Code to require landlords to provide tenants notice whenever any over-the-counter (OTC) pesticide or herbicide is applied to the property by anyone other than a licensed pest control operator (PCO). The following Q & A

1 0

A P A R T M E N T

helps explain the new law. 1. What were the old notice requirements, and what does SB 328 do? Prior to SB 328, when landlords applied OTC pesticides or herbicides (hereinafter referred to as “pesticides”) to their property without using a licensed pest control operator, they were generally not required to provide specific notice to tenants regarding

N E W S

n

w w w . a a o c . c o m

n

pesticide use. The only time notice was required prior to applying a pesticide was when a landlord needed to enter the tenant’s dwelling to apply a pesticide. That notice is a general notice requirement that requires landlords to give his or her tenants 24-hour notice prior to entering the tenant’s dwelling subject to limited and specific reasons. Under SB 328, however, landlords will now be required to provide their

F E B R U A R Y

2 0 1 6


tenants with specific notice as described herein prior to applying any pesticides inside the tenants unit and in the common area of the property, including over-the-counter pesticides like RAID, and herbicides, like Roundup. The new notice requirement is separate and distinct from the notice required when pesticides are applied by a licensed pest control operator. The PCO notice, which remains unchanged, requires notice to be provided to tenants and prospective tenants whenever a PCO applies pesticides to the property.

Smock/Kingston — continued from page 11 •

It is being applied on a routine basis.

Inside a dwelling unit: landlords may give the notice in any of the following ways: (A) First-class mail; (B) Personal delivery to the tenant, someone of suitable age and discretion at the premises, or under the usual entry door of the premises; (C) Electronic delivery, if the tenant has provided an electronic mailing address; (D) Posting a written notice in a conspicuous place at the unit entry in a manner in which a reasonable person would discover the notice. Common area: when applying pesticides to a common area, the notice must be provided by posting the notice in a conspicuous place where the pesticide will be applied. The notice must remain up for at least 24 hours. If the common area lacks a suitable place to post the notice, then notice may be provided in the same way notice is provided when applying a pesticide inside of a dwelling unit (see above). is anywhere on the property outside of a dwelling unit, and is shared by tenants of different dwelling units. Common areas, therefore, include stairways, hallways, backyards, front yards, pool areas, etc. Single-family homes and many duplexes do not have common areas, because the areas of the property are unlikely to be shared. For properties without common areas, landlords should follow notice rules when applying pesticides anywhere on the property as if they are apply them “inside a dwelling unit.” Routine application of pesticides: When a landlord applies pesticides to a common area on a routine basis, he or she does not have to give notice to tenants prior to each application. Instead, the landlord may give a onetime notice to all tenants that include the schedule of application. The landlord must also provide notice to new tenants prior to entering a lease agreement. If the pesticide used is ever changed, a new notice listing the new pesticide must be provided. 4. Do landlords have to give notice to the neighboring units of dwellings where pesticides are applied? In some circumstances, neighboring tenants must also be provided notice PRIOR to the commencement of the

N E W S

n

w w w . a a o c . c o m

n

application. Specifically, if making broadcast applications (spreading pesticide over an area greater than two square feet), or using foggers or aerosol sprays, notice must also be given to any tenant in an adjacent dwelling unit (a dwelling unit that is directly beside, above, or below a particular dwelling unit) if those neighboring tenants “could reasonably be impacted by the pesticide use.” The standard for determining whether a neighboring tenant could reasonably be impacted is a legal standard that is based on common sense. 5. When must notice be provided to a tenant? When applying pesticides inside of a dwelling unit, landlords must provide notice to the tenant of that dwelling 24-hours in advance, unless an exception applies (see Question 6 below). The 24-hour rule also applies to situations in which a landlord is required to provide notice to neighbors. When landlords apply pesticides to a common area (anywhere else on the property), the 24-hour notice is not required. Instead, the law requires notice to provided sometime “before” applying the pesticide. That means a landlord can post the notice right Smock/Kingston — continued on page 14

Smock/Kingston — continued from page 12 before he or she applies the pesticide. 6. When does the 24-hour notice rule not apply? Upon receipt of written notification, the tenant may agree in writing, or if notification was electronically delivered, the tenant may agree through electronic delivery, to waive the 24-hour waiting period and allow the landlord to apply a pesticide immediately or at an agreed upon time. If the tenant is unavailable to physically see the notice, the tenant may: • Orally waive the right to see the notice, • Waive the 24-hour waiting period, and • Agree orally to an immediate pesticide application. The landlord, however, must verbally inform the tenant of the name

and brand of the pesticide product proposed to be used prior to application. The landlord must also leave the written notice in a conspicuous place in the dwelling unit, or at the entrance of the unit in a manner in which a reasonable person would discover the notice, at the time of application. If any neighboring tenants in adjacent dwelling units are also required to be notified as discussed in Question #4, the landlord must provide those tenants with written notice as soon as practicable after the oral agreement is made authorizing immediate pesticide application, but in no case later than commencement of application of the pesticide. 7. What pesticides are covered under the new law? A landlord must give notice to tenants prior to applying any pesticide. Pesticide is defined as “any substance, or mixture of substances, that is intended to be used for controlling, destroying, repelling, or mitigating any pest or

organism.” Therefore “pesticides” includes any kind of commercially available, over-the-counter pesticides you can buy at your local hardware store or supermarket, that are intended to kill pests. The definition includes herbicides. You are not required to give notice when applying antimicrobial products like sterilizers, disinfectants, sanitizers, antiseptics, and germicides. Antimicrobial products are used to address microbiological organisms, bacteria, viruses, fungi, algae, protozoa, and slime. They are also used to protect inanimate objects (for example floors and walls), industrial processes or systems, surfaces, water, or other chemical substances from contamination, fouling, or deterioration. 8. What if there is an emergency and pesticides must be applied to a common area right away? If there is an emergency, like a giant wasps nest is found in a common area, and/or the pest poses an immediate

threat to health and safety, landlords may apply pesticides to address the emergency, and then post the required notice afterwards. Notice must be posted as soon as practicable afterwards, but not later than one hour after the pesticide is applied. 9. Are There Additional Landlord Pesticide Disclosure Obligations? No. The new law reads in pertinent part: “If a tenant is provided notice in compliance with this section, a landlord or authorized agent is not required to provide additional information, and the information shall be deemed adequate to inform the tenant regarding the application of pesticides.”

10. What about bed bugs? Chemicals used to exterminate bed bugs are considered pesticides. Therefore, these rules apply. However, if a PCO treats a bed bug infestation with chemicals, the PCO is required to adhere to existing law governing notice and use of chemicals. 11. What is the benefit of SB 328? The duty to provide written notice to tenants and prospective tenants regarding the use of pesticides is now defined. Note. The information provided herein is intended to give general guidance and awareness on SB 328 and shall not be construed in any way as a substitute for individual legal advice. Those that require specific advice should consult an attorney. To obtain a copy of the new law, please see Senate Bill 328 (Chapter 278, Statutes of 2015) at: leginfo.ca.gov

Legal Corner — Questions & Answers BY ST E P H E N C . D U R I N G E R , E S Q .

I

’ve always treated my resident managers as independent contractors, just swapped out rent for management services, seemed easier to just swap out rent for services, less paperwork, less hassle, seemed to work just fine for years. I understand that there have been some changes in the law and that I’m not supposed to do it that way any longer, is that true?

Yes, there have been some changes in the law the past couple of years regarding the relationship between a resident manager and the owner or management company employer. There has been a huge increase in labor board claims and litigation against landlords regarding this issue, in part due to the outrageous penalties, fees, costs and other damages that can be awarded due to noncompliance. Claims typically

range from $50,000 to over $300,000! A resident manager is an employee of the owner or management company, not an independent contractor. A written manager’s agreement, voluntarily signed by the employer and the resident manager is very important; ensure that you are using the most current form provided by your local apartment Q&A — continued on page 18

Q&A — continued from page 16 association. If the manager does not agree in writing that the reduced or free rent is to be credited against the manager’s wages otherwise owed under California’s minimum wage law, then that credit is illegal and the manager must be retroactively paid for each hour worked, in some cases going back four years. Most agreements will require that the employee prepare and submit a record, or a log, of days and hours worked. California law requires the employer to maintain time records of total hours worked per day and document when the employee started and stopped work each day. In addition, the employer should require a signed certification from the manager detailing the total hours worked during the preceding pay period. If a manager is required to live on site as a condition of employment, then the maximum credit that the owner or management company may apply to the resident

1 8

A P A R T M E N T

manager’s wages which would otherwise be due was the lower of two thirds of the market rent or $508.38 per month for a single manager and $752.02 per month for a couple for the calendar year 2015. These monthly amounts increased to the lower of two thirds of the market rent or $564.81 and $835.49 respectively this past January 1, 2016. Ensure that the hourly rate used complies with the minimum wage laws, for 2015 it was $9.00 per hour, and is now $10.00 per hour effective January 1, 2016. And if that is not all to contend with, every employer must provide all employees who work thirty days or more per year with paid sick leave. Sick days will accrue at a rate of one hour for every 30 hours worked. For example, employees who work 90 hours in one month would accrue three hours of paid sick leave for that month. An employer may limit the employee’s use of paid sick days to 24 hours (or three days) in each year of employment. Employees are entitled to use accrued

paid sick days as early as the ninetieth day of employment. Accrued but unused paid sick days carry over to the following year of employment. Additionally, in the event employers require that their employees use their personal cell phones to perform their duties, then the employer must reimburse for a reasonable percentage of the employee’s phone bill. Lots of stuff to keep in mind, contact a qualified labor law attorney for further clarification.

I just received a very strange letter. Seems my local police department has identified one of my residents as an undesirable; they say he’s suspected of being a gang banger and is dealing drugs and tagging the neighborhood. They say that if I don’t evict him, the police will prosecute me for allowing a criminal to operate on my property. I may even lose my property! The family has been there for several years, other than a couple bounced checks they have been

F E B R U A R Y

2 0 1 6


model tenants. This is the first I’ve heard of this, no one has ever complained before, no complaints, no drugs, and no graffiti or tagging around my building, Help! I can’t afford a vacancy right now, and I think that the police might be wrong, what do I do?

In this upside down and crazy world we live in today, this actually is a growing trend in law enforcement. With a revolving door judicial system acting more like a ‘catch and release’ fishing excursion than one that metes out consequences for truly bad behavior, law enforcement is focusing on the easier prey, landlords, in controlling crime in their jurisdictions. Rather than prosecute the criminal, go figure, many law enforcement agencies are taking the lazy way out and threatening the law abiding landlord, forcing them to evict the resident. Rather than locking up the bad guys, seems like the current trend is to simply shuffle them off to another community. If the police are certain he is dealing drugs and tagging, seems like the right thing to do would be to arrest him, prosecute him fully and send him off to the “gray bar hotel.” If the letter you received is inconsistent with your experience with your resident, follow up with the police department by asking for documentation supporting their claim. Ask them to provide specific incidents, dates and times of wrongdoing. Have there been arrests on the property? Have illegal drugs been found there? Ask the office to identify any witnesses that would be

willing to testify in court, if necessary. Ask other residents in the building, gather independent information. If the information you gather supports your resident’s involvement in criminal activity, take action immediately. Consult your attorney to determine if you have enough facts to support a three day nuisance notice, or if a thirty day or a sixty day notice is appropriate. Remember, a letter from the police department is not sufficient evidence in court to base a nuisance notice on; testimony from percipient witnesses will be required in the event the resident contests the unlawful detainer action.

I’ve been thinking of installing a drop box somewhere on my property so that the residents can put their rent checks in it. I’m thinking I’ll save them a stamp and get the rents sooner. Any problem with doing this?

Many landlords do exactly that, most with absolutely no problems whatsoever. If you are considering the practice, it is very important to install a secure box that cannot be removed or broken into, and provide your residents with written procedures regarding the use of the drop box. Specifically, inform the residents that use of the box is optional; that they may use it for their convenience, but that there always is a risk of loss or theft. Rent will not be considered paid until you actually receive their check. And of course, never deposit cash. Also provide the residents with a physical

address where they can personally deliver the rent, not a PO Box, if they prefer not to deposit the rent into the drop box. By not requiring the use of the drop box, the resident will bear the risk of loss, until you actually receive the rent. If you mandate the use of a drop box, and fail to provide a physical address for payment, or require payment to be made to a PO Box, courts will find that the risk of loss transfers to you upon their placement in the drop box, or in the mail. Federal Focus — The NAA Connection BY GR EG BROWN

Happy New Year!

A

t long last, we are inside 2016; the year where major change is guaranteed in at least one of our branches of government and where there is potential for change is one of the others. The Obama Administration comes to end at the close of this year. Whether the new occupant at 1600 Pennsylvania Avenue is of the same or opposite party, there will be a new voice at the bully pulpit, a new approach to

leading the nation and, indeed, the world. In the Congress, the House of Representatives will stay in the same party’s hands — barring something crazy happening elsewhere in the political machine — while the Senate is once again up for grabs. Senate Republicans will struggle and strive to maintain their slim majority while House Republicans will attempt to preserve the scale of theirs. Of course, that is 11 months from now and we have miles to go before we sleep (or pass out from campaign fatigue). At the close of 2015, Congress and the President had knocked out a number of big policy items for the near term thereby smoothing out some potential bumps in the road this year. The federal debt limit has been lifted until March 2017 (no game of chicken over the full faith and credit of the U.S.). The federal budget levels for 2016 and 2017 have been set (much less chance of govern-

STEVEN D. SILVERSTEIN Attorney at Law

14351 Redhill Ave., Suite G Tustin, California 92780 Evictions processed in Orange, L.A., Riverside & San Bernardino Counties

(714) 832-3651 FAX (714) 832-7781

www.stevendsilverstein.com evictions@stevendsilverstein.com 2 0

A P A R T M E N T

N E W S

ment shutdown). Several perennial annual tax extenders were made permanent while several others were extended for multiple years (much diminished chase for another year of life for temporary tax provisions). Finally, the highway trust fund was replenished for five years (road crews of the world rejoice!). This bevy of work the Congress completed before leaving for the holidays included victories for the apartment industry, especially in the tax arena where all of our priorities in the tax extenders package were either extended or made permanent. These include bonus depreciation, small business expensing, energy efficiency and affordable housing development. See the Dec. 28 edition of the Apartment Advocate for details on these victories. Not all was shiny for us, however, in the final legislative package that is now law. Proposed language to prevent funding for the Environmental Protection Agency being used to enforce the Waters of the United States or “WOTUS” rule was dropped in the final negotiations. This rule is widely opposed by industries, state governments and others and would negatively impact not only new development of apartment homes but also existing communities. A federal court has stayed the rule for now, but that is not a permanent solution so look Federal Focus — continued on page 22

Federal Focus — continued from page 20 for more advocacy on this in 2016. In what feels like a rare event, we did score a nice victory in the rules from the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) regarding treatment of expenses to acquire, maintain and improve tangible property, including apartment buildings. NAA and the National Multifamily Housing Council had vigorously advocated for a healthy amount of deduction available to taxpayers without an

applicable financial statement or “AFS” in the year of purchase of an item versus having to depreciate that item over several years. The initial amount in the IRS rule was $500 which in our view was far too low. At the end of November, this deduction amount was increased to $2,500 for those taxpayers without an AFS. For more details, see the Dec. 21 edition of the Apartment Advocate. This is a substantial victory and an excellent example of apartment industry advocacy in action.

Dear Maintenance Men BY J E R RY L’E C UY E R & F R AN K ALVAR E Z

D

ear Maintenance Men: I own a small apartment building with an average amount of landscaping around the property. I have a garden service that comes each week; they cut and edge and do what their supposed to do, I think, although they don’t spent a lot of time at the property. What should I expect from my landscapers or garden service? John

Dear John: We have a minimum list of items that must be completed at a property. If these items are skipped or ignored, we feel the property will suffer. On a weekly basis, we expect the garden service to provide the following:

1. Cut the grass.

3. Pull out weeds between the sidewalk cracks, walk around the building, including the alley. 4. Turn over the dirt in all the flowerbeds each week. 5. Pick up any trash around the property. 6. Broom, blow or hose down the

2. Edge the grass.

Maintenance — continued from page 24 walkways. 7. Turn on the sprinkler lines, check for clogged heads, broken lines etc. 8. Check that the timer is set properly. 9. Cut, trim and thin any shrubs or bushes. 10. Maintain communication with the owner about problems or improvements

The above list takes time, half hour minimum at a small property. If your landscape gardener completed the list on a weekly basis, you could very well have the best-looking property on the block! Which means higher rents…if you add color flowers…even higher rents! Finding a landscape gardener to do above list consistently is not easy. Ask your local apartment association for recommendations or look in your neighborhood or city for a property with outstanding landscaping and ask

who the gardener is. Have him give you a quote according to your “list”. Keep in mind a landscape company or gardener who give the above service will charge more than a “blow and go” gardener, however your property will reflect their above average service. Dear Maintenance Men: My building gets hit by graffiti on a regular basis. How can I stop this curse? Jim Dear Jim: We understand. Our company maintains several properties that attract graffiti like a magnet. There are several solutions that may help.

1. Painting over graffiti as quickly as possible will help deter future vandalism. We recommend painting over the same day or within 24 hours of the graffiti appearing on your property. Graffiti vandals like to advertise. By removing the graffiti quickly, the less recognition the vandals will receive, thus making your building less attractive to graffiti taggers. 2. Install lighting in areas prone to graffiti. Motion activated lights also work well to deter vandals. If you have a sense of humor, install motion activated water sprinklers. 3. Planting vines or bushes along a wall or the side of the building is a good long-term solution. As the landscape grows, it will make it more difficult to graffiti your walls. Dear Maintenance Men: I have an opportunity to buy a small power snake for cleaning out kitchen & bathroom drains. At the rate my tenants block their drains it should pay for its self in no time. Maintenance — continued from page 26 is a good reason to buy a power tool. But…most bathroom and kitchen drains can be cleared with a three-foot hand snake. The tub or shower will typically have a hair stoppage just past the tub shoe and the bathroom sink will have a toothpaste and hair stoppage in the trap before the wall. The kitchen sink will typically be stopped on the garbage disposal side because of improper usage of the disposer. If both sides of the kitchen sink are blocked, then it may be necessary to use the power snake. Power snakes can be very dangerous. Most operate with a ¼ to ½ horse motor, which packs quite a punch, especially if your finger or arm gets caught! If you buy this snake, we highly recommend that you get some training on your machine. Power drain cleaning is very much an “art” when done well. Knowing when you hit the stoppage and when the snake is snagged comes

with experience. A broken snake cable in your drain system will be far more expensive than simply calling an experienced plumber when needed. Another thought is; most kitchen stoppages are caused by grease. Your snake will only temporarily clear the stoppage. Getting a company to “Hydro-Jet” your drains every year may help cure your chronic grease stoppages.

Overcoming the Top Objection: Price BY MINDY WILLIAMS

I

n a poll across the country on Rent & Retain’s Facebook page (Facebook.com/RentandRetain), these were the three most common objections: Price, Storage, and “I need to think about.” Let’s talk price here. Price This is a big one, whether you run daily specials or are utilizing a revenue management system. So how do you come back after your prospect says that’s not within their budget? 1. Estimate what your prospect pays in utilities. Whether you offer energy efficient appliances or if your community includes utilities like water, cable or trash, there are savings to be noted. 2. Determine what luxuries your prospect pays for outside of their housing expenses. For example, a gym membership could be cancelled in lieu of your community’s fitness facility and pool. Or your clubhouse may offer free Wi-Fi

and coffee bar to cut down on trips to Starbucks.

If utilities or wireless Internet are included, that’s a biggie. I am saving $120 a month because I got rid of cable TV. However, if it was included in my rent, that would be a big plus for me to live at your community.

3. Create value. While many want to pay less for rent, they are willing to pay more if they feel they are getting a good deal. Talk about all the perks offered by your Management Company, resident events, maintenance-free living, upgraded anything (carpet, flooring, window treatments, microwave, drinks/towels at the pool, etc.). I’m getting my hair done right now (multitasking at it’s best...) and three customers around me are charging their phones at the salon. Do you need to offer a “charge” as a perk? Add extra outlets if you can, have a “charge” center in your leasing office for folks, remember

that this is a new service people didn’t need a few years ago (charging stations and more outlets). There was a recent poll on Facebook asking if you had to charge your phone in one place, where would it be: the kitchen or the bedroom? The kitchen was the winner. So if you can add a power strip under the kitchen counter or somewhere accessible, do it and use it as a selling tool. Little things add value. What Characteristics Make the Best Salesperson? BY LISA TROSIEN

F

or years, regardless of the industry, people held the belief that extroverts — those individuals that are extremely sociable and outgoing — were the best salespeople. It’s natural to believe this. Extroverts are drawn to jobs in sales, so these positions are full of this personality type. Surprisingly, that belief has been proven wrong by a series of studies. There is a personality type, called ambivert, that you may have never even heard of. But the ambivert personality — one with both introvert and extrovert characteristics — tends to be a superior salesperson. In a test administered by the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ania, ambivert salespeople earned 24% more than their introvert counterparts and 32% than their extrovert team members. What was also interesting...introverts and extroverts closed about the same number of

prospects. So, what does all this have to do with you? The answer depends on your role at your company. If you hire salespeople, look to hire more ambiverts. Don’t be so quick to hire the super-sociable, totally outgoing candidate. Look for the person that knows how to balance listening and taking the lead. If you’re an extroverted salesperson, try to dial down the enthusiasm. Overly enthusiastic salespeople may overwhelm some customers. They also have a tendency to talk too much and listen too little. Try to strike a balance between being assertive and holding back. Ambiverts are naturals at this. If you train salespeople, put an emphasis on listening skills, questioning skills and adjusting their assertiveness. Lessen the emphasis on closing the sale and more on creating the balance within the salesperson.

If you’d like to learn more about ambiverts and selling, read Daniel Pink’s book, “To Sell Is Human”.
